SYMPOSIUM G
SYNCHROTRON RADIATION IN MATERIALS SCIENCE
This Symposium aims at bringing together researchers that currently apply synchrotron
radiation based experimental techniques to materials science and technology,
using synchrotron facilities located in Brazil and abroad. The goal is to provide
an overview of their latest accomplishments related to a broad range of materials,
including inorganic materials as well as biomaterials and polymers.
Recent synchrotron based investigations of electronic, atomic, molecular and
supramolecular structures of nanostructured materials will be presented and
discussed. Particular attention will be addressed to the applications of synchrotron
radiation techniques to advanced materials with potential industrial interest,
such as electronic and photonic materials, catalysts, magnetic alloys, amorphous
materials, sol-gel based materials including precursor colloidal solutions,
engineering materials, and others.

This Symposium will also deal with recent theoretical and experimental developments
associated to different synchrotron based experimental techniques, such as X-ray
spectroscopy (EXAFS, XANES), X-ray diffraction, X-ray fluorescence, small-angle
X-ray scattering (SAXS), X-ray contrast and phase based imaging techniques,
and soft X-ray and VUV photoelectron spectroscopies.
The Symposium will consist of invited lectures and submitted communications.
Selected submitted communications will be presented orally and the others in
a poster session.
